Journalist Breaks Guinness World Record with 75-Hour Interview Marathon in Abuja

History has been made in Nigeria’s capital! In the full glare of the world and under the inspiration of a nation, Chibuike Livinus Victor, a brave and dynamo Nigerian journalist, has broken the Guinness World Record by completing an incredible 75-hour interview marathon, a triumph that sets the bar higher for endurance, for narrative, and for African journalism.

The marathon started right on time at 12:20 PM on Tuesday, April 15, 2025, and ended on Sunday, April 20, 2025, at 3:40 PM.

Chibuike worked day and night for three days and three nights, going far above the requirement of 72 hours and 30 seconds of interviews, and pushing the boundaries to a record-breaking 75 hours of informative, interesting interviews.

“I did not do it for fame,” Chibuike announced as soon as he finished his last session, tired but full of pride.

“I did it for all the voices that were not heard in Nigeria, for the power of stories, and to demonstrate to the world what Nigerian journalists are capable of doing.”

Hosted at the picturesque Harrow Golf Club in Abuja, the record-breaking event hosted more than 150 varied guests covering a broad spectrum of subject matter such as politics, entertainment, current affairs, state of the nation, business, and agriculture.

Attendees included a sizable number of fellow journalists who brought new ideas and were part of the celebration of the profession that the marathon itself was a tribute to.

With every one of his guests, Chibuike asked piercing questions, gentle empathy, and the sort of journalistic brilliance that had viewers glued to their seats hour after hour.

The effort adhered to strict Guinness World Record guidelines, with a team of expert medical professionals, nutritionists, timekeepers, and technical staff on hand throughout the marathon to monitor compliance and safety.
